What Makes a Life Insurance Company “The Best”?

Before we explore the top contenders, it’s important to understand the benchmarks used to rank life insurers. Here are the key factors:

1. Financial Strength & Stability

A reliable life insurance company must have a strong financial foundation to fulfill long-term obligations. Independent rating agencies like AM Best, Fitch Ratings, Moody’s, and Standard & Poor’s provide insights into the financial health of insurers.

2. Claims Settlement Ratio

This is the percentage of claims the company settles out of the total received. A high ratio (typically above 95%) indicates trustworthiness and efficient claims management.

3. Range of Insurance Products

The best companies offer diverse policies to suit various life stages, including:

  • Term Life Insurance

  • Whole Life Insurance

  • Universal Life Insurance

  • Variable Life Insurance

  • Endowment Plans

  • Riders (critical illness, accidental death, disability waiver, etc.)

4. Customer Service

Quick response times, helpful representatives, and accessible digital tools enhance the overall policyholder experience.

5. Premium Affordability

Pricing transparency and value for money are key. Some companies may offer cheaper plans, but with limited coverage.

6. Digital Innovation

In today’s tech-driven world, the top insurers offer intuitive mobile apps, online policy management, digital claim filing, and AI-powered customer support.

Top 10 Best Life Insurance Companies in 2025

Based on the above criteria, here are the top 10 life insurance companies that have consistently ranked among the best in the industry:

1. Northwestern Mutual (USA)

Overview:

Founded in 1857, Northwestern Mutual consistently ranks as one of the top life insurers in the U.S. It’s well-known for its financial strength and customer satisfaction.

Why It’s Among the Best:

  • Offers both term and whole life policies.

  • Highest financial rating: A++ from AM Best.

  • Dividends paid to policyholders annually.

  • Extensive network of financial advisors.

  • Excellent for high-net-worth individuals.

2. New York Life (USA)

Overview:

New York Life, established in 1845, is the largest mutual life insurer in the United States. It is policyholder-owned, which means profits are returned to policyholders through dividends.

Standout Features:

  • A++ financial strength rating.

  • Wide product portfolio: term, whole, universal, and variable life.

  • Exceptional financial planning services.

  • Robust rider customization.

  • Great for long-term planning and estate management.

3. MetLife (Global Presence)

Overview:

MetLife serves over 90 million customers worldwide and has a strong presence in over 40 countries. It is a preferred choice for corporate group life insurance.

Why MetLife Shines:

  • Comprehensive group and individual life policies.

  • Competitive rates for term policies.

  • Fast digital claims process.

  • Strong global financial standing.

  • User-friendly mobile app and portal.

4. Prudential Financial (USA, UK, Asia)

Overview:

Prudential is a global financial services giant offering a wide range of life and investment-linked insurance products.

Key Benefits:

  • Leading in variable and indexed universal life products.

  • High claims payout ratio.

  • Known for insuring people with pre-existing conditions.

  • Flexible policy customization.

5. State Farm (USA)

Overview:

Although better known for auto and home insurance, State Farm also provides excellent life insurance offerings.

Notable Highlights:

  • Affordable term life premiums.

  • Strong customer service ratings.

  • Simple application process.

  • Best for budget-conscious consumers.

6. Legal & General (UK, US)

Overview:

Legal & General is one of the UK’s oldest and most trusted life insurance providers. It also operates in the U.S. under Banner Life Insurance.

Why It’s Excellent:

  • Affordable term life products.

  • High TrustPilot ratings.

  • Solid underwriting for individuals with medical conditions.

  • Smooth online experience.

7. AIA Group (Asia-Pacific)

Overview:

AIA is the largest publicly listed pan-Asian life insurance group. It operates in 18 markets including China, Australia, India, and Malaysia.

Distinct Features:

  • Exceptional health and wellness integration.

  • Flexible premium terms.

  • Strong focus on critical illness and riders.

  • Modernized, tech-based policyholder experience.

8. Sun Life Financial (Canada, Asia, USA)

Overview:

Sun Life has built a reputation as a client-first company with emphasis on investment-linked life insurance products.

Highlights:

  • Smart financial planning tools.

  • High performance in universal life plans.

  • Strong market share in Canada and Asia.

  • Offers hybrid plans (insurance + investments).

9. AXA (Europe, Africa, Asia)

Overview:

AXA is a French multinational insurance conglomerate offering diversified life insurance solutions with investment, pension, and retirement benefits.

What Sets AXA Apart:

  • Strong digital platforms.

  • Multilingual support in several countries.

  • Competitive pricing in Europe and Asia.

  • High level of transparency and social responsibility.

10. Allianz (Germany, Global Reach)

Overview:

Headquartered in Germany, Allianz serves over 100 million customers in more than 70 countries. Its life insurance arm is globally renowned for its robust risk management and digital strength.

Top Features:

  • Competitive returns on investment-linked plans.

  • Good for retirement planning.

  • Reliable for expatriates and global nomads.

  • Multi-currency policies available.

Tips for Choosing the Right Life Insurance Company

1. Assess Your Needs

Are you looking for temporary coverage or lifelong protection? Term policies are cheaper but don’t accumulate cash value. Whole and universal life offer long-term savings but cost more.

2. Check the Insurer’s Financial Ratings

Stick with companies rated A or higher by rating agencies to ensure stability.

3. Read the Fine Print

Review policy exclusions, grace periods, renewal terms, and cancellation clauses.

4. Compare Quotes Online

Use official insurance comparison websites and aggregators. Always get quotes from at least 3 to 5 providers.

5. Review Customer Feedback

Explore online reviews, Reddit forums, Trustpilot, and Better Business Bureau ratings.

6. Seek Professional Advice

If confused, consult a licensed life insurance advisor or financial planner.

Emerging Trends Among Top Life Insurance Companies in 2025

1. AI and Machine Learning in Underwriting

Many top insurers are now using AI to assess risk, improving speed and precision.

2. Digital-First Experience

Leading life insurance companies offer instant policy issuance, digital signature capabilities, and 24/7 chatbot support.

3. Wellness-Linked Premium Discounts

Companies like AIA and Vitality offer discounts for policyholders who maintain a healthy lifestyle and track activity via smart devices.

4. Microinsurance and Subscription Plans

In developing nations, companies like AXA and Old Mutual offer pay-as-you-go life insurance for low-income groups.

5. Climate and ESG Focus

Insurers are increasingly evaluated on their Environmental, Social, and Governance (ESG) commitments—particularly for sustainable investments.
